love locked


I saw this yesterday on the Münsterbrücke. The ribbon reads "Jenny & Martin heiraten!" (Jenny & Martin getting married!). Looks like Jenny and Martin got the idea of using a lock to seal their love from other couples doing the same in Rome. (full story here). I wonder if this new tradition will catch on in Zurich as well.

chicken bride

A few days ago Eric in Paris showed us a picture of a Parisian bachelor/bachelorette party. Here's one I spotted in the Zurich train station last week. Much like bachelorette parties elsewhere, some form of public humiliation is involved: she had to wander around dressed as a chicken and request donations from strangers. They don't really call it 'hen night' in German, so the chicken outfit was somewhat of a coincidence. I'm not sure what it is with the Swiss and their apparent obsession with chicken costumes.

yay! more snow!

It snowed overnight again! For those of us who were disappointed by the mild winter and the less than ideal ski conditions this season, this late winter blast is pretty exciting. Perhaps we can squeeze in a another ski weekend or two.

So, in honor of the snow, here's another snow picture. This path leads to a church that's less than 100 meters from my house. Yes, it's pretty, but the 20 minute cacophony of church bells at around 9:30 am on weekends wakes me up when I'm trying to sleep in. There is another 20 minute churchbell extravaganza at around 7:00 pm every evening, but thankfully I'm usually not home for that. Church bells also go off every 15 minutes, around the clock, to mark the quarter hour. Plus, every hour, on the hour, there is a series of DONGs corresponding to to the time. So every night at midnight, I'm 'blessed' with the sound of 4 DINGs followed by 12 louder DONGs...

neumühle-quai

Yesterday was a beautiful sunny day in Zurich, and everyone was out and about strolling along the river and the lake. This tree-lined path on the east side of the Limmat River stretches from Central to the Letten, which is a popular swimming area in the summer. I love the way the tree branches curve over the path and hang over the river.
